Hogwarts Legacy sorting hat quiz guide

The Hogwarts Legacy sorting hat quiz in the game is just one question.

  • “What does the sorting hat sense in you” – Daring, Curiosity, Loyalty, Ambition

This is far shorter than what is available on the quiz online, which is comprised of dozens of questions. Which option you choose will determine which house you get into. Ambition is for Slytherin, Loyalty is for Hufflepuff, Daring is for Gryffindor, and Curiosity is for Ravenclaw.

Once you choose the option you will have a moment to confirm you do want to be a part of that house as you aren’t able to change things up afterwards. So, be sure to know which of the Hogwarts Legacy houses you want to be a part of.

Hogwarts Legacy has drawn considerable criticism during its development, largely due to the fact that the creator of the Harry Potter series, J.K. Rowling, has made a number of transphobic remarks on social media in recent years.

While Avalanche has confirmed that J.K. Rowling is not “directly involved” in the development of Hogwarts Legacy, it is working with “her team” and Portkey Games, a Warner Bros. label dedicated to launching new experiences inspired by J.K. Rowling’s original stories. It is currently unclear whether she will earn any royalties from the game’s sale, but it is likely given it is based on her original body of work.
